I’m loving both of these dresses that came out from the same thrift store because both are different in their own right.  The solid black Shoshanna dress with the stitching, collar & sleeves are what I find unique about this dress.  The black & white Jackson Pollack inspired DVF reissued wrap dress is timeless.  In 1997 DVF relaunched her line of wrap dresses and each season has included a reissued print or 2 from her 1970′s collections.  So this Jackson Pollack print was a print from the 70′s and just how frigging cool is that?  I plucked both of these lovely ladies right out from the same thrift store so if I can do it so can you, all you need is time, patience & knowledge…. Keep keeping it “green” because I’m your luxury curator!
